Search efforts suspended for Illes Benedek Incze in Vík í Mýrdal

Tuesday 17th 2024 on 18:39 in  
Iceland

Search efforts for Illes Benedek Incze, a Hungarian national reported missing in Vík í Mýrdal, have been suspended as of now. Illes was last seen around 3 AM on September 16 and failed to show up for work the following day, raising concerns about his whereabouts.

Approximately 100 rescue workers had been conducting searches since late yesterday, utilizing drones and thermal imaging technology to navigate poor visibility in the area. However, authorities reported that the search yielded no new leads, prompting the decision to halt operations for the time being. There is currently no suspicion of foul play surrounding his disappearance.

The Suðurland police department continues to investigate the case and is gathering further information. They have expressed gratitude to all those who participated in the search efforts. Members of the public who may have information regarding Illes’ activities after 3 AM on September 16 are encouraged to contact the police via email.
